I applied online. The process took 4 weeks. I interviewed at AT&T (Grand Rapids, MI) in Oct 2009
Interview
The first steps are basic personality and intelligence tests done online. The you get an email saying you have been chosen to move on to skills testing. You go to an ATT location and take a skills test where you role play acting as a customer service sales consultant who answers customer calls about their accounts. Once you pass the skills test you are asked to come to a face to face interview. In this interview you are asked a list of standard questions "tell me about a time when..........", then you are given a product description and a list of options. When they re-enter the room it is your job to role play a phone call where you are trying to find the appropriate product to sell to the client who has called concerning another issue. You are never asked any questions about yourself personally, your work ethic or values.
